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a short-term d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But in case you want your waste recycled, you may have to really go about it in a somewhat different fashion. Waste in the majority of temporary dumpsters is not recycled since the containers are so large and hold so much material.
If you're interested in recycling any waste from your endeavor, check into getting smaller containers. Many garbage pickup firms in Miami have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. All these are usually sm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
In case you'd like to recycle, figure out whether the company you're working with uses single stream recycling (you do not have to sort the substance) or in the event you will need to form the recyclable material into various contain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This can really make a difference in the total number of containers you should rent.
Choosing the most effective dumpster for your project size
Choosing the best dumpster for your project is an important aspect of garbage pickup in Miami. Should you choose a dumpster that is too small, you won't have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you will have to schedule additional trips. In the event you select one that is too big, you will save time, but you will waste money.
Should you call a garbage pickup company in Miami and describe the job for which you need a dumpster, they can advocate the finest size. Their years of experience mean that they generally get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ster generally functions well for medium-sized clean-up projects and little rem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the most suitable choice for big home clean-up projects and medium-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ls which are perfect for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a big house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used just on the biggest projects such as new construction.

10 yard dumpster measurements in Miami
A 10 yard dumpster is built to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ure approximately 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will change with different businesses.
It might be difficult to choose just the container size you'll need for your home end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ller cleanup occupations. To provide you with an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you do not desire an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
Can I Use a Roll off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as allow rolloff dumpsters. When you have a driveway, then you can normally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by placing it on the road.
Some jobs, though, will necessitate placing the dumpster on the road. If this applies to you personally, then you should speak to your city to discover whether you need to get any permits before renting the dumpster. Generally, cities will let you keep a dumpster on a residential road for a brief quantity of time. If you believe you'll need to be sure that it stays to the road for a number of weeks or months, though, you will need to get a license.
Contacting your local permits and licensing office is usually recommended. Even supposing it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ll learn that you're following the law.

Junk removal vs garbage pickup in Miami - Which is good for you?
If you own a project you're going to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your garbage and crap for you, or if you should just rent a dumpster in Miami and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better solution if you want the flexibility to load it on your own time and you don't mind doing it yourself to save on job. Dumpsters also function nicely in the event you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ll offs normally begin at 10 cubic yards, thus should you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for a lot more dumpster than you desire.
Garbage or rubbish removal makes more sense if you want another person to load your old things. Additionally, it functions nicely should you want it to be taken away quickly so it is out of your hair, or in the event you simply have a few large items; this is likely c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.
What's the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features that make them useful for various kinds of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your project location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ops and a door on the front. This makes it easy for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a helpful option for businesses that collect consid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are usually left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. This makes it possible for sterilization professionals to eliminate garbage and junk for multiple homes and businesses in the area at reasonable prices.

20 yard dumpster dimensions in Miami
A 20 yard dumpster can hold about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Normal d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can hold about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This means that the 20-yarder is a standard size for occupations that involve cleanup from larger endeavors. Due to its compact size that still has capacity for a good quantity of debris, a 20 yard container is just one of typically the most popular dumpster sizes for house projects.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container comprise:
- Clean-Up from a basement, attic or garage
- Flooring and carpeting removal from a sizable house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of
Do I need a license to rent a dumpster in Miami?
If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Miami, you may not understand what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. Should you plan to place the dumpster entirely on your own property, you're not ordinarily required to get a license.
If, nevertheless, your job requires you to put the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this may usually mean you have to submit an application for a license. It is always advisable to check with your local city or county offices (perhaps the parking enforcement office) in case you own a question concerning the demand for a license on a road.
Should you neglect to get a license and find out later that you were required to have one, you'll prob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most garbage pickup in Miami c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
